Just to give you an idea how badly I got this information from www.laserpointersafety.com

  • The power density from a 1 milliwatt laser, focused to a point, is brighter than the equivalent area of the sun’s surface.
  • This can cause a detectable change (injury) to the retina, if the laser stays in one spot for a few seconds
  • In extreme cases, central vision could be almost fully lost, and the person becomes blind in that eye.

It’s literally all fun and game until someone loses eyesight. That last fact, the complete lose of eyesight is of course in extreme cases and in the US and most countries only a 5 milliwatt is the highest you can get but this can still cause blind spots in the eye because obviously if only a 1 milliwatt laser is as brighter than the equivalent of the SUN than a 5 miliwatt is even worse.
